so thanks so much guys , i was in a second hand book store and found a copy of THE HANDBOOK OF EPILEPSY
second edition, Thomas R. Browne and Gregory L. Holmes
it's giving me a bit more insight, but it was really wierd , i found i read and was amazed. there is a whole section on my symptoms under simple partial seizures and some other stuff under cps, so it appear's to be coming from the frontal lobe somewhere. you see i did think i was going crazy as my symptoms where, dreams states, color changes in the inviroment, very visaul.
i will let you all know what my eeg says , as soon as they have a take home one avail there's a long wating list for them. and only 1 unit in Queensland where i live.
